The Swedish Committee Against Antisemitism (SKMA) awarded their 2023 ELSA Prize to the Jewish Youth Association of Sweden (JUS). This was awarded to them for their significant efforts to counter antisemitism and to enlighten Jewish life and identity in Sweden.

In October, a delegation representing NextGen attended the WJC Executive Committee in Zagreb, Croatia. Here they discussed the ongoing war in Israel, the rise of antisemitism in their home communities and around the world, as well as the importance of women empowerment in Jewish spaces.

In her most recent blog for the Times of Israel, Danielle Sobkin, a current Lauder Fellow, and a peer of hers from The Ohio State University, discuss how the saying "Never Again" which is often used when referring to the Holocaust is relevant again. They talk about how although "Never Again" is rooted in historical facts, the recent events we're seeing unfolding are a reminder of it's contemporary significance.

Emma Hallali, Former Lauder Fellow and current JD Academy Member and President of the European Union of Jewish Students was recently quoted in an article from the Guardian. She spoke to them about how Jewish students across the European continent were feeling scared and that universities were largely ignoring concerns from Jewish student organizations
